The National Hispanic Business Group’s 32nd Annual Gala -2017

The  National Hispanic Business Group’s 32nd Annual Gala  2017 was held at Cipriani Wall Street NY ,with over 300 people in attendance , The Following were honored:  Hispanic Achievement in Government Award Wendy Garcia, Chief Diversity Officer ,Office of the New York City Comptroller .Corporate Appreciation Award  to Susan Hogan, Supplier Diversity Manager Procumbent Organization,Public Service Enterprise Group Inc, (PSEG).Corporate Hispanic Advocacy Award to Mayra Maisch, Vice President  head of America’s real estate development ,Goldman Sachs and Co. Public  sector Appreciation Award, to Anthony Peterson, Director Diversity Program , Hugh L. Carey  Battery Park City Authority.

Lisa Mateo ,Host Celebrity taste makers Reporter, PIX 11 Morning News , was the Emcee for the event. Chef  Ricardo Cardona was the guest chef ,music by Charan  Salsa and Scholarships were presented to 3 students.

The National Hispanic Business Group (NHBG) was founded in 1985 by a group of prominent Hispanic entrepreneurs with a vision to create an organization entrusted with developing opportunities for Hispanic Businesses.  Our goal is to seek out and expand our opportunities for its members by fostering dialogue and economic exchange with the Public and Private sectors, while supporting social change and community empowerment.
